Job Description:
[b]Responsibilities:[/b]
- Lead the design process from concept to production for new products and updates.
- Collaborate with product manag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to ensure alignment on design strategies.
- Mentor and guide a team of product designers to foster a culture of creativity and innovation.
- Conduct user research and usability testing to inform design decisions and understand customer needs.
- Develop high-quality design solutions through wireframes, visual and graphic designs, flow diagrams, and prototypes.
- Present and communicate design ideas and concepts to internal teams and stakeholders.
- Stay updated on industry trends and continually seek to improve design standards and processes.
[b]Requirements:[/b]
- Proven experience as a Product Designer, with a minimum of 3-5 years in a design leadership role.
- Strong portfolio showcasing successful product design projects and expertise in product design tools like Sketch, Figma, or Adobe Creative Suite.
- Excellent understanding of user-centered design principles and practices.
- Strong communication and presentation skills, with the ability to articulate design rationale clearly.
- Ability to manage multiple projects and deliver high-quality results on time.
- Experience working in a cross-functional team environment and collaborating with various stakeholders.
-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
[b]Qualifications:[/b]
- Bachelor's degree in Design, Interaction Design, HCI, or a related field; or equivalent practical experience.
- Experience in managing and mentoring a team of designers.
- Proficiency in both interaction design and visual design.
- Knowledge of responsive design principles and practices.
- Familiarity with HTML, CSS, and basic understanding of web development practices is a plus.
- Enthusiasm for working in-person in a collaborative team environment on a full-time basis.
